#4c08ee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#4c08ee is composed of 29.8% red, 3.1% green and 93.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 68.1% cyan, 96.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 6.7% black. It has a hue angle of 257.7 degrees, a saturation of 93.5% and a lightness of 48.2%. #4c08ee color hex could be obtained by blending #9810ff with #0000dd. Closest websafe color is: #3300ff.

#4c08ee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#4c08ee has RGB values of R:76, G:8, B:238 and CMYK values of C:0.68, M:0.97, Y:0, K:0.07. Its decimal value is 4983022.
